The role

The post holder will provide clerical and administrative support to the Cleft Collective research study within Bristol Dental School for seven hours a week. They will be required to support the administrative processes such as collating study materials, scanning and verifying data and supporting the Cleft Collective team in other administrative duties.

What will you be doing?

Prepare and distribute materials (such as questionnaires, consent forms, newsletters and reminders) any other study-related correspondence via the appropriate method.

Enter data from questionnaires, records and other sources onto Excel and other required databases. Verify incoming participant data.

Help with the preparation of research reports for the funders of The Cleft Collective

Use relevant method of communication to contact practices to request information relating to the study maintaining a constant awareness and observance of confidentiality issues, consent and GDPR requirements.

Respond to participant enquiries received via telephone, email or post under the supervision of more senior colleagues.

Maintain efficient office systems and perform a range of general office duties that include answering the telephone, photocopying, filing and updating the contact database with new details efficiently and effectively.

Maintain and regulate stationery stocks and other consumables.

Organise meetings e.g. book rooms, arrange catering and take minutes.

Update research web pages under supervision and update project social media pages.
